Description
We measure the correlation between the spin of the top quark and the
spin of the anti-top quark in $t\bar{t} \rightarrow W^{+}bW^{-}\bar{b}$
final states produced in $p\bar{p}$ collisions at a center of mass energy $\sqrt{s}=1.96$~TeV,
using data collected with the D0 detector at the Fermilab Tevatron collider.
The correlation is extracted using a double differential angular distribution
and a novel technique using matrix element integration is used to increase
the sensitivity of the result, Measurements are performed in both the
dilepton and lepton+jets final states.
